'Evanescence' is an experimental work bringing two fragile elements of nature together, capturing their reaction at the moment of contact. Water and flowers come with their inherent beauty – both are fragile, both have ephemeral forms. The delicate nature of flowers is contrasted with the frozen power of water, the crystalline effect achieved by the use of high speed flashes.

Soups are not alien to Indian cusine as its generally thought so....
Here's the recipe for Tomato -Pudina(Indian mint) soup.
Tomato-mint Soup
Ingredients :
3 large boiled tomatoes
1 tbsp butter
tsp a little chopped green chilly
1 & tsp sugar (optional)
2 tsp spring onion and carrot, chopped
tsp ginger paste
1 tsp corn flour
5-6 finely chopped mint [pudina] leaves
Salt to taste
Method :
Peel off the skin of the tomatoes.
In a mixes add tomatoes and chilly and make a fine paste.
In a kadai /pan add 1 tbsp Butter.
To this add the tomato paste.
Boil till red color is obtained.
Then add sugar, mint leaves, chopped spring onions carrot and ginger paste.
Then add corn flour paste. Add salt. While serving garnish with a few chopped.

It is named after Afonso de Albuquerque. This was an exquisite and expensive variety of mango, that he used to bring on his journeys to Goa. The locals took to calling it Aphoos in Konkani and in Maharashtra the pronunciation got further transformed to Hapoos. This variety then was taken to the Konkan region of Maharashtra and other parts of India.
The southern district of Ratnagiri and south northern parts of Sindhudurg in Maharashtra state, including regions around the Devgad and Taluka, produce the finest quality alphonso mangoes in India. Alphonso is also cultivated largely in Pune. The southern districts of Valsad and Navsari in Gujarat state and particularly Alphonso mangoes from the Amalsad region (including villages such as Dhamadachha, Kacholi, and all villages of Gandevi) produce Alphonso mangoes as well. Southern States in India are also major mango producing areas. From north to south, climatic changes occur which result in differences in the quality of the produce. Even in Ratnagiri and Devgad the finest fruit comes from a patch of 20 km from the seashore.
The variety grown in Devgad in the Kokan region of Maharashtra is supposed to be the best.

This is an authentic Maharashtrian sweet dish recipe cooked on festivals.......
Ingredients
1 cup Basmati rice, washed and drained
1 tbsp ghee
1 cup sugar and a little more than cup water for the paak (sugar syrup)
4-5 lavanga (cloves)
tsp cardamom powder
8-10 cashewnuts, halved
a good sized pinch of keshar (saffron) strands, soaked in a little milk or water
1 tsp lime juice (optional)
Method
Heat the ghee, when hot add the cloves and cook till the colour of cloves starts changes (don't let them burn).
Add the rice and sautee a bit.
Add two cups water and cook the rice.
When the rice is cooked, gently spread it in a plate and let cool.
Combine the sugar and water. Let the mixture cook till you get a thick syrup. You know the paak is done when a drop of paak put on a metal plate holds it shape and doesn't run. This is referred to as a golibunda paak.
Add the lemon juice (if using), saffron, cardamom powder, cashews, and the rice to the syrup.
Cover and cook till the water evaporates.
The rice tastes better the next day, after all the flavours have had a change to mingle.
